Prep and Cook Time

  • Planning: 10 minutes
  • Cooking: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es

Yield

Makes approximately 6 medium-sized waffles, perfect for serving 3-4 people.

Difficulty Level

Easy to Medium – ideal for both gluten-free beginners and experienced cooks looking to elevate their breakfast game.

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 cups gluten-free all-purpose flour blend (ensure it contains xanthan gum or add ½ tsp separately)
  • 2 tbsp granulated sugar (adds just the right hint of sweetness)
  • 1 tbsp baking powder (gluten-free, for lightness)
  • ¼ tsp baking soda
  • ¼ tsp fine sea salt
  • 1 ¼ cups almond milk (or coconut milk for extra richness)
  • 2 large eggs, room temperature
  • 4 tbsp melted coconut oil (plus extra for the waffle iron)
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at your waffle iron according to the manufacturer’s instructions, brushing it lightly wiht coconut oil to prevent sticking.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the gluten-free flour blend,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t until well combined and aerated.
  3. In a separate bowl, beat the eggs thoroughly, than add almond milk, melted coconut oil, and vanilla extract; whisk to create a smooth, unified mixture.
  4.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ir gently with a spatula until just combined. The batter shoudl be slightly thick but pourable; avoid overmixing to maintain fluffiness.
  5. Instantly ladle the batter onto the preheated waffle iron, using about ½ cup per waffle (adjust according to the size of your iron).
  6. Cook for 4-6 minutes or until steam subsides and waffles are golden brown with crisp edges.Use a fork to gently lift one corner to check the texture.
  7. Remove waffles carefully and keep warm on a wire rack while cooking the remaining batter to preserve crispness.

Chef’s Notes & Tips for Success

  • using a high-quality gluten-free flour blend that includes xanthan gum is critical for that classic waffle elasticity. If your blend lacks gum,adding ½ tsp xanthan gum creates structure without toughness.
  • For even lighter waffles, separate the egg whites and beat them until soft peaks form; gently fold into the batter as the last step.
  • Make sure your coconut oil is fully melted and warm-not hot-to blend evenly without cooking the eggs prematurely.
  • Don’t rush the cooking process-allow the waffle iron to finish wholly to develop the ideal crispy crust that contrasts beautifully with the tender crumb.
  • Waffles can be made in advance! Simply layer between parchment sheets and freeze. Reheat in a toaster or oven to revive crispiness.

Tasty Toppings and Pairings to Complement Your Waffles

To enhance your fluffy gluten-free waffles, consider a vibrant array of toppings. A dusting of powdered sugar paired with fresh berries like raspberries, blueberries, or sliced strawberries adds freshness and color that pop against the golden waffle backdrop. For indulgence,smooth almond butter or a drizzle of pure maple syrup introduces a luscious sweetness that seeps into every tender bite.

For a savory contrast, dollops of dairy-free Greek-style yogurt with a sprinkle of toasted pecans or a pinch of cinnamon create a delightful balance. Warm fruit compotes, like spiced apple or cherry, are luxurious partners that add moisture and an aromatic depth. Elevate presentation with mint sprigs or edible flowers, transforming your plate into a breakfast masterpiece.

Helpful Tips to Perfect Your Gluten-Free Waffle Routine

  • Consistency is key: Adjust the almond milk quantity slightly if your batter feels too thick or thin-aim for a pourable but thick batter to ensure waffles puff up beautifully.
  • Keep your equipment ready: A well-preheated waffle iron will ensure the perfect crisp exterior-never skip this step.
  • Test your first waffle: Waffles cook differently in every iron; sampling the first can help you judge cooking time and adjust the heat if needed.
  • Rest the batter: Allow the batter to sit for 5 minutes after mixing to hydrate the flour properly, enhancing texture.
  • Use fresh ingredients: Baking powder and soda lose potency over time, wich can flatten your waffles; fresh leavening agents are essential.

Q&A

Q&A: Fluffy Gluten-Free Waffles: A Delicious Morning Boost

Q1: What makes these gluten-free waffles so fluffy compared to typical recipes?
A1: The secret to their fluffiness lies in the right balance of gluten-free flours combined with leavening agents like baking powder and a bit of whipped egg whites. This creates light air pockets throughout the batter, resulting in waffles that are tender yet airy, reminiscent of conventional waffles but completely gluten-free.

Q2: Can I use any gluten-free flour blend, or are some better for waffles?
A2: While many gluten-free flour blends work, those with a mix of rice flour, tapioca starch, and potato starch tend to yield the best texture for waffles. These flours add a delicate crumb and a slight chewiness, perfect for maintaining fluffiness without heaviness.

Q3: How do I ensure the waffles have a crispy exterior and a soft inside?
A3: Preheating your waffle iron thoroughly is key. Also, adding a touch of oil or melted butter to the batter helps create that crispy golden crust while keeping the interior moist. Avoid overmixing the batter to prevent deflating the air bubbles that contribute to fluffiness.

Q4: Are there natural ingredients that can boost the flavor without adding gluten?
A4: Absolutely! Vanilla extract, cinnamon, and a hint of nutmeg brighten the flavor profile without affecting gluten content. Fresh or powdered citrus zest, like orange or lemon, also adds a lively twist that pairs beautifully with sweet toppings.

Q5: Can these waffles be made vegan as well as gluten-free?
A5: Yes! Substituting eggs with a flaxseed or chia seed “egg” (1 tablespoon ground seeds mixed with 3 tablespoons water) and using plant-based milk instead of dairy keeps the waffles fluffy and moist while being completely vegan and gluten-free.

Q6: What are some delicious, gluten-free toppings to pair with these waffles?
A6: Fresh berries, sliced bananas, pure maple syrup, and nut butters are all marvelous choices. For a protein-packed boost, try topping with Greek yogurt or almond yogurt and a drizzle of honey or agave syrup. Toasted nuts or seeds can add a delightful crunch.

Q7: can I prepare the batter ahead of time?
A7: The batter is best used fresh to maintain maximum rise and fluffiness, but you can prepare it the night before and give it a gentle stir before cooking. Keep it refrigerated and avoid overmixing when you’re ready to make your waffles.

Q8: How can I store leftover waffles and reheat them without losing texture?
A8: Leftover waffles can be frozen individually on a baking sheet, then stored in a sealed bag. To reheat, pop them into a toaster or oven at moderate heat until crisp again. This method keeps them nearly as good as freshly made waffles.

Q9: Is there a way to add extra nutrition to the waffles without compromising taste?
A9: Incorporating ground flaxseed or chia seeds adds fiber and omega-3s,while a spoonful of almond meal can introduce healthy fats and protein. These additions blend seamlessly into the batter, enhancing nutrition while keeping the waffles fluffy and delicious.
